In the category of “you're not going to believe this!” comes Dave Hopla, the world's greatest basketball shooter of all time! Sure the UConn Huskies can shoot and so can those guys in the NBA, but Dave Hopla is a phenomenal shot and a tremendous instructor and he brings his unique abilities to Litchfield County on the weekend of December 12th and 13th.
Litchfield Parks and Recreation has teamed up with the Torrington PAL Basketball league to organize shooting clinics with Dave Hopla.
The younger boys and girls, in grades 5-8 will have their clinics in the mornings of both days from 8:30 am until 11:30 am at the Forman School Gymnasium.
The high school players will have their shooting clinics at Torrington's Vogel-Wetmore School in the afternoons from 1:00 pm until 4:00 pm.
Dave has taught shooting to Michael Jordan, Kobe Bryant, Gilbert Arenas, and Caron Butler, just to name of few. For the inside scoop on Dave Hopla go to his website at www.davehopla.com and see all his unbelievable shooting statistics.
